Police: 4 teens pushed, robbed 1 man on Beaufort street

A group of teens allegedly threw a man to the ground and robbed him Tuesday night in Beaufort.

The victim told police four males who appeared to be between 16 and 17 years old approached him as he was walking on Duke Street toward Bladen Street around 11 p.m., according to Beaufort Police Department spokeswoman Sgt. Hope Able. The man was not injured, but his black bag worth approximately $75 was stolen.

One of the teens allegedly asked the victim for money before he pushed him to the ground, Able said. The victim did not know the suspects, and there were no threats communicated. They left the area on foot, but a direction was not specified in the police report. The victim flagged down an officer patrolling the area about 30 minutes later.

No description of the suspects was available beyond the estimated ages.
